【.cmd】 バッチファイルスクリプト %15 【.bat】 (768レス)
前次1-
抽出解除 レス栞

137: デフォルトの名無しさん [sage] 2023/01/04(水) 06:05:18.72 ID:3FgVyKvV(1) AAS
外部リンク:qiita.com
219: デフォルトの名無しさん [sage] 2023/03/08(水) 05:54:33.72 ID:AsCwI7z1(1) AAS
Ruby なら、glob, birthtime を使う。
ただし、DryRun なので実際には削除されません

require 'fileutils'
require 'date'

Prev_day_30 = Date.today - 30 # 今日の30日前

# 絶対パスのディレクトリ名の後ろに、* を付けること!
# . で始まる、隠し directory, file を除く
glob_pattern = "C:/Users/Owner/Documents/test/*"

Dir.glob( glob_pattern ).select do |full_path|
stat = File.stat full_path
date = stat.birthtime.to_date # 作成日付

# ファイルで、作成日付が今日の30日前以前のものだけ。30日前も含む
stat.file? && date <= Prev_day_30
end
.each { |full_path| FileUtils::DryRun.rm( full_path ) } # ファイルを削除
226
(1): デフォルトの名無しさん [sage] 2023/03/10(金) 18:36:07.72 ID:3mB0yP28(1) AAS
for /F
248: デフォルトの名無しさん [sage] 2023/04/20(木) 22:07:04.72 ID:dJqrvGvM(1) AAS
クリーンインストールでやる場合はISOイメージをカスタマイズする必要あると思うし
このスレの範疇をだいぶ超えてるような気がする
ひょっとすると外人ならbatファイル一発でやる「技」を持ってるかもしれないね
394
(1): デフォルトの名無しさん [sage] 2023/07/07(金) 14:50:24.72 ID:T33gGQqj(2/2) AAS
このスレへ書かれたわけだから、敢えてバッチファイル縛りのマゾプレイしてるけど、
何使ってもいいのなら、一番長く使ってきて慣れている C で書くよ。高速だし。
541: デフォルトの名無しさん [sage] 2024/06/15(土) 23:26:37.72 ID:UQXtemWf(3/4) AAS
D&Dは止めた方がいいね
最近の過去ログに無理やりやるのがあったと思うがまあ止めといたほうがいい
もっと運用を考えるべきだね
607: デフォルトの名無しさん [sage] 2024/11/09(土) 19:20:02.72 ID:KYeqqNmx(1) AAS
ここはキモイ人ばっかりですから問題ないです笑
前次1-
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ル

ぬこの手 ぬこTOP 0.037s